    Not being able to arrive any earlier than 4 or stay later than 10 on departure. I know this was attributed to pandemic but not convinced the deep clean couldn't be achieved sooner....and I speak as someone who has fully conformed to the rules!

    Rosedale has been special to my family for decades and so the chance to stay right in the village was great. The exterior has a lovely cottage look whilst the modern extended kitchen diner lounge was brilliant. Because of the pandemic only one pub; The Coach House; was open but its was very close by and we enjoyed the meals. (booking almost essential) The two shops/cafes are very good and minutes away. Very easy access to lovely walks and the market town of Pickering a short scenic journey away. Many other beautiful villages and coastal towns in easy reach. Loved the table and decking out the back and as we had some lovely weather it was a great place to start the day. Also the bench out the front was a lovely place to while away an hour. Birdsong in the garden was glorious.
